Most skiers never fix their edge control. They just ski more β and reinforce the same bad habits.
Edge control isn't built on the mountain. It's built through repetition with immediate feedback β something most people only get one week a year, if that.
Here are the 5 principles we coach at every SkyTechSport session:
01 β Weight into the outside ski. Every clean turn starts here.
02 β Progressive engagement. Build edge angle gradually. Never snap.
03 β Hips forward, always. Forward lean is control, not aggression.
04 β Slow speed first. Precision at slow speed becomes power at race speed.
05 β Record every session. Your body lies. The replay doesn't.
